DA-CAR SAAD gave P3M worth of agri-infrastructure

Farmer cooperatives and associations (FCAs) from Mountain Province received agri-infrastructure interventions from the Department of Agriculture-Cordillera (DA-CAR) through the Special Area for Agricultural Development (SAAD) program.

During a turn-over ceremony in Bontoc, Mountain Province recently DA-CAR SAAD awarded certificates of turnover and acceptance to seven FCAs for the completion of various facilities like storage sheds, swine housing, and poultry housing.

The FCAs awarded were Agawa Farmers and Fisherfolk Organization from Besao, Aguid Gardeners Association from Sagada, Anabel Faith Farmers and Fisherfolk Association from Sadanga, Latang Association for Agricultural Development from Barlig, Napua Farmers Timpuyog Organization from Sabangan, Docos Farmers Organization, Inc. from Sagada, and Kiodan Kataguwan Di Umili Organization from Bauko.

Aside from pigs and feeds that were previously given, the turned over infrastructures are part of the enterprise development plans the FCAs have created. These plans contain not only the blueprints of the project, but also the guidelines on how to sustain the projects even if the government support has ended.

The combined amount of the projects totaled to around P3 million.

DA-CAR Regional Executive Director (RED) Cameron Odsey assured the farmer-beneficiaries that the assistance would continue despite the SAAD program Phase 1 ending soon. 

“Eventually, SAAD Phase 1 will be concluded this year. Hence, Phase 2 will also commence. But that doesn’t mean that DA’s assistance ends there. We have other programs for those municipalities that were not included as SAAD beneficiaries,” Odsey said in Kankanaey. He also encouraged the farmers to continue to implement their enterprise plans, as well as the LGUs to continue to monitor these projects.

“From our end [DA], we will also continue our support. So, let us help each other. Regardless of the size of the assistance we receive, we should take care of it,” Odsey further expressed.

Meanwhile, officials from the different local government units (LGUs) of Mountain Province expressed their commitment to support the FCAs and the intervention programs of the DA-CAR. 

“I would like to extend my thanks to DA-CAR for the programs that you gave in the municipality of Bauko. Most of your interventions coming from SAAD and the Office of [RED] are focused on the development of Bauko. As we commit to support the farmers, we will also continue our support to the programs of DA,” expressed Bauko mayor Randolf Awisan.

“The Municipal Agriculture Office of Sagada also commits to include you [Sagada FCAs] into the masterlist of DA-funded projects, as we will do a proper monitoring of the DA-funded and LGU-funded projects,” Sagada municipal agriculture officer Carmen Fumeg-as explained. 

The beneficiaries also thanked DA-CAR for the continuous support. “We express our massive gratitude to SAAD from the feeds to the [swine] housing that you provided. You were an instrument given by God to give us blessings. We will take good care of the things you gave us, so that we can also share these with our barangay,” Napua Farmers Timpuyog Organization chair Clover Felipe expressed. By JBPeralta
